Pitch & Weather Report
Pitch Report
The Pallekele surface is known as the highest-scoring ground in Sri Lanka.
- Nature: A balanced surface with fresh grass that offers significant seam movement early on.
- Spin vs Pace: Pacers have a slight edge (57.5% wickets), but as the shine disappears, spinners like Maheesh Theekshana become lethal.
- Fantasy Impact: Batters can capitalize on the Powerplay impact before the surface slows down in the middle overs. Scoreboard pressure is vital, as chasing teams often struggle under lights.
Weather Summary
Current conditions in Pallekele are cloudy with a temperature of 22°C. For the match timeframe, expect cloudy skies with a high of 24°C and a low of 18°C. While daytime rain chances are low at 10%, there is a 35% chance of rain at night, which could bring the DLS method into play.

Key Player Analysis
- Maheesh Theekshana (Bowler): The “Mystery” man. His ability to bowl in the powerplay and at the death with control makes him a fantasy goldmine.
- Travis Head (Batter): Due for a big one. He averages nearly 30 against SL with a strike rate of 163.
- Dasun Shanaka (All-rounder): Loves playing Australia. His last match at this venue against them yielded a match-winning 54* off 25 balls.
